A Level 2 Electrician, typically colloquially referred to as a "Level 2 ASP" (Accredited Service Provider), is not simply any sparky with a larger series of tools. Their accreditation is a testament to rigorous training, substantial experience, and a deep understanding of the intricate operations of the electrical power circulation network. They are authorised to deal with or near the poles and wires that bring power from the street to your residential or commercial property, a domain generally scheduled for the major provider. This includes whatever from the service fuse to the point of accessory on a building, and even extends to underground service mains and overhead connections.
The breadth of services a Level 2 Electrician can provide is substantial and varied. Among their primary functions involves the installation, repair work, and upkeep of overhead and underground service lines that connect a home to the primary power grid. This is essential for new builds requiring a power connection, existing residential or commercial properties needing an upgrade to their service capacity, or in circumstances where storm damage has compromised the stability of the lines. Imagine a freshly constructed home, prepared for tenancy, however without any power; it's the Level 2 ASP who bridges that critical space.
Moreover, they are authorised to manage disconnections and reconnections of power. This might be needed during considerable remodellings where the mains need to be briefly de-energised for safety, or when a property is being destroyed. On the other hand, when building and construction is total or a new tenant moves in, they are the ones who securely restore the power supply, making sure everything is compliant with the latest electrical standards and network regulations. This crucial function underpins the smooth operation of home transfers and development tasks.
Metering is another significant location of know-how for these experienced tradespeople. They are accountable for the setup, relocation, and replacement of electrical power meters, consisting of the advanced wise meters that are becoming progressively prevalent. Ensuring accurate energy measurement is vital for billing and network management, and a Level 2 Electrician possesses the check here specific qualifications to work on these sensitive gadgets without compromising the stability of the data or the security of the connection. Their work here straight impacts every power bill gotten by consumers.
Beyond these core services, Level 2 Electricians likewise undertake important defect correction. If an electrical safety inspection recognizes problems with the service mains or point of accessory that position a danger, it's typically a Level 2 ASP who is hired to remedy these potentially harmful scenarios. This could include upgrading old cable televisions, repairing damaged pole attachments, or making sure earthing systems are certified and efficient. Their proactive and reactive work in this area straight contributes to public safety and the reliability of the grid.
Their function is also crucial in emergency situation situations. When extreme weather occasions trigger prevalent power blackouts due to fallen lines or harmed poles, these certified professionals are often on the cutting edge, working relentlessly to restore power. Their capability to securely deal with live electrical systems, combined with their deep understanding of network facilities, makes them vital throughout times of crisis. They work in combination with larger utility companies, frequently acting as the hands-on specialists for localised repair work and connections.
To become a Level 2 Electrician, an individual must first be a completely qualified and experienced basic electrician. They then go through extensive additional training and rigorous assessments to gain accreditation from the relevant energy circulation network service provider in their jurisdiction. This accreditation is not a one-off accomplishment; it requires ongoing expert development and adherence to strict security procedures and technical requirements. This constant knowing ensures they stay abreast of evolving technologies and policies, ensuring the highest level of proficiency and safety in their specialised field.
